Our People: Management

Dawn Cranswick 

Dr Dawn Cranswick (CEO)

Dawn is chief executive of PNE Group, with responsibility for all aspects of organisational planning and performance.  This includes strategy development, staff development and working with the non-executive board.  She has specific expertise in management consultancy - including fund management and evaluation of fund management - and has undertaken assignments in Africa, the Far East, Middle East, and both Central and Eastern Europe.  Dawn has a PhD in Management, a Master's degree in Quality Management and is a qualified Leadership Coach.  Outside of work she is a keen reader, gym member and is learning to speak German.


Karen Bellis
 

Karen Bellis

Karen is international operations director for the Shell LiveWIRE programme delivered by PNE Group on behalf of Shell International in over 20 countries.  She has wide knowledge and experience of International development on a country and global level.  Karen has specific expertise in building multi-disciplinary delivery partnerships around the world and has regular engagement at national government level in LiveWIRE countries of operation.  Karen studied agriculture at Aberystwyth, holds a PGCE and continually updates on international relations and economics.  Outside of work Karen is a national office holder in the Women's Food and Farming Union and plays an active role on various organisations' boards. 

 
Richard Clark

Richard Clark

Richard is the director of workspace at PNE Group.  Before this he was research and development officer at Northumbria tourist board.  He has been involved in a wide range of economic development activities including micro finance, business incubators, technology projects and economic development consultancy.  He is a director of North East Workspace Ltd, Designworks (Gateshead) Ltd, Silicon Alley (Newcastle upon Tyne) Ltd and Newcastle Youth Enterprise Centre.  He also acts as the UK expert on the benchmarking of incubators.

 
Tracey Moore

Tracey Moore

Tracey is the development manager at PNE Group.  Tracey is responsible for the management of the voluntary sector team and ensuring that all projects and services are delivered effectively and in line with both funder requirements and the needs of the voluntary sector.  Her role also requires her to identify new business opportunities and implement new projects and services.  Alongside her management role at PNE, Tracey is also a qualified assessor, executive coach and consultant.  Outside of work she is a school governor and is currently studying for an Executive MBA at Newcastle University. 


Gary Nagel 

Gary Nagel

Gary is the head of IT at PNE Group and is responsible for strategy, planning and IT service delivery.  He has over 20 years' management experience of implementing IT solutions to a range of private and public sector clients both in the UK and internationally.  A Prince2 qualified IT professional, he has a specialism with Internet technologies management including: multilingual websites, social networking applications, learning management systems, SEO, hosting/domain management and a range of multimedia developments.  A former international runner, Gary still has a keen interest in athletics and plods the streets of Tyneside.
